LinkedIn

You can connect a personal profile or a company page, but not both in the same brand. If you need to track both, use two brands. Analytics and inbox are only available for company pages.

To connect a personal profile, use your login credentials. To connect a company page, you need super administrator permissions on your personal profile.

  1. Open the connections dashboard.

  2. Click Connect a LinkedIn account. A LinkedIn pop-up window will appear.

  3. Log in to your personal LinkedIn account and grant access.

  4. Select your personal profile or one of the company pages where you are a super administrator.

If LinkedIn connectivity is a challenge, see I can't connect LinkedIn.

The LinkedIn profile picture is no longer public, so the API no longer returns it for new connections.

Google Business Profile

To connect a Google Business Profile location, you need the right permissions on the Google account. See Permissions in Google Business Profile.

Most roles can connect a location, but some Google API changes may require owner access for some accounts.

  1. Open the connections dashboard.

  2. Click Connect a Google Business Profile account. A Google pop-up window will appear.

  3. Log in to your Google account, or select it if you are already logged in.

  4. Grant all requested permissions and continue.

  5. Select the location you want to connect.

No locations are listed

If you see We have not found any locations related to this account, try these checks:

  • Make sure you are signed in with the correct Google account.

  • If you have a manager role, ask an owner to connect instead.

For more details, see Permissions in Google Business Profile.

YouTube

You need admin permissions on the YouTube channel before you connect it.

You must have permission in the channel settings. Permissions in YouTube Studio are not enough.

  1. Open the connections dashboard.

  2. Click Connect a YouTube channel. A Google pop-up window will appear.

  3. Log in to your Google account, or select it if you are already logged in.

  4. Grant all requested permissions and continue.

  5. Select the channel you want to connect. If there is only one channel, it connects automatically.

If your main channel name does not appear, select the email account shown and the channel will connect.

Meta Ads

To connect a Meta Ads account, make sure:

  • The ad account is assigned as an active asset in your Business Manager profile. See Meta Ads permissions.

  • You have full or partial access to the ad account, with Manage campaigns enabled.

If a Facebook Page is already connected, the admin who connected that page must also be an admin of the ad account you want to link. If needed, reconnect the page with the correct admin by following How to refresh your social media connection.
